To inform the public about the disease of alcoholism and substance abuse through information and education, to promote early treatment and rehabilitation of persons with drinking problems and/or substance abuse problems, their families and their children, to increase public awareness of alcoholism, to advocate and/or develop essential services for the treatment and prevention of substance abuse, to provide consultation services to interested persons and community leaders.
New York State Office of Alcoholism and Substance Abuse Services Certified Prevention Provider.
The Council has been committed to providing a high-quality prevention services to school districts, communities, businesses, and colleges. To ensure a comprehensive approach, we have adopted and implemented the following strategies from the National Council on Alcoholism and Drug Dependence, Inc., NCADD:
Provide objective information and referrals for individuals and family members seeking treatment for various addictions.
Provide community-based prevention, education and training programs, as well as local media awareness campaigns.
Advocate for the rights of alcoholic and drug dependent persons and their families at the local, state and national levels.
Increase awareness and understanding through programs at schools, churches, youth centers, senior centers, civic and community organizations.
